Three-minute HIV test approved by FDA

The Food and Drug Administration on Thursday approved Canada-based MedMira Inc.'s Reveal Rapid HIV-1 Antibody Test, which can provide results in about three minutes, for marketing in the United States. The test kit will be distributed exclusively to U.S. health care providers by Cardinal Health, a provider of health care products and services, and shipment will begin immediately, MedMira officials said. The test is the fastest HIV antibody test available in the world and can detect HIV antibodies in blood serum or plasma. "We are very pleased to enter the United States market with the best rapid HIV test to date," said MedMira CEO Stephen Sham. The company earlier this month received approval to market the HIV test in China.
